Like any technical textbook, the first printing of the 3rd edition contained minor errors—a sign error in an equation, a mislabeled graph, or a typo in a problem’s answer key. As of 2024–2025, Wiley and Razavi released an official errata sheet (a list of corrections). A “updated PDF” implies that these errata have been baked into the digital file—fixing the errors directly on the pages so you don’t have to cross-reference a separate sheet.
